Output 6592597d6d722b81ca8d7ecb53bc3021709f32a116583e1a7de8d809c360a0a3:0

value
154188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a22d0e549c4a3d866b49a44c63d91e8e3588684 OP_EQUAL
address
3HCcWDJX6D4bvzchcRzBGvNZqwoe2GSsri
transaction
6592597d6d722b81ca8d7ecb53bc3021709f32a116583e1a7de8d809c360a0a3